Class MouseEvent
Namespace: Aspose.Html.Dom.Events
Assembly: Aspose.HTML.dll (25.1.0)
واجهة MouseEvent توفر معلومات سياقية محددة مرتبطة بأحداث الفأرة.
[ComVisible(true)]
[DOMObject]
[DOMName("MouseEvent")]
public class MouseEvent : UIEvent, INotifyPropertyChanged
الوراثة
object ← DOMObject ← Event ← UIEvent ← MouseEvent
المشتقات
التنفيذ
الأعضاء الموروثة
UIEvent.View, UIEvent.Detail, Event.NonePhase, Event.CapturingPhase, Event.AtTargetPhase, Event.BubblingPhase, Event.InitEvent(string, bool, bool), Event.PreventDefault(), Event.StopPropagation(), Event.StopImmediatePropagation(), Event.Bubbles, Event.Cancelable, Event.CurrentTarget, Event.EventPhase, Event.Target, Event.TimeStamp, Event.Type, Event.DefaultPrevented, Event.IsTrusted, DOMObject.GetPlatformType(), object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
المنشئات
MouseEvent(string)
يهيئ مثيلًا جديدًا من فئة Aspose.Html.Dom.Events.MouseEvent.
[DOMConstructor]
public MouseEvent(string type)
المعلمات
type
string
نوع الحدث.
MouseEvent(string, IDictionary<string, object="">)
يهيئ مثيلًا جديدًا من فئة Aspose.Html.Dom.Events.MouseEvent.
[DOMConstructor]
public MouseEvent(string type, IDictionary<string, object=""> eventInitDict)
المعلمات
type
string
نوع الحدث.
eventInitDict
IDictionary<string, object>
قاموس تهيئة الحدث.
الخصائص
AltKey
تشير إلى خاصية altKey.
[DOMName("altKey")]
public bool AltKey { get; }
قيمة الخاصية
Button
خلال أحداث الفأرة الناتجة عن ضغط أو إفراج عن زر الفأرة، يجب استخدام Button للإشارة إلى أي زر من جهاز المؤشر قد تغيرت حالته.
[DOMName("button")]
public short Button { get; }
قيمة الخاصية
Buttons
خلال أي أحداث للفأرة، يجب استخدام Buttons للإشارة إلى أي مجموعة من أزرار الفأرة يتم الضغط عليها حاليًا، معبرًا عنها كقناع بت.
[DOMName("buttons")]
public ushort Buttons { get; }
قيمة الخاصية
ClientX
الإحداثي الأفقي الذي وقع فيه الحدث بالنسبة لواجهة العرض المرتبطة بالحدث.
[DOMName("clientX")]
public long ClientX { get; }
قيمة الخاصية
ClientY
الإحداثي الرأسي الذي وقع فيه الحدث بالنسبة لواجهة العرض المرتبطة بالحدث.
[DOMName("clientY")]
public long ClientY { get; }
قيمة الخاصية
CtrlKey
تشير إلى خاصية ctrlKey.
[DOMName("ctrlKey")]
public bool CtrlKey { get; }
قيمة الخاصية
MetaKey
تشير إلى خاصية metaKey.
[DOMName("metaKey")]
public bool MetaKey { get; }
قيمة الخاصية
RelatedTarget
تستخدم لتحديد EventTarget ثانوي مرتبط بحدث واجهة المستخدم، اعتمادًا على نوع الحدث.
[DOMName("relatedTarget")]
public EventTarget RelatedTarget { get; }
قيمة الخاصية
ScreenX
الإحداثي الأفقي الذي وقع فيه الحدث بالنسبة لأصل نظام إحداثيات الشاشة.
[DOMName("screenX")]
public long ScreenX { get; }
قيمة الخاصية
ScreenY
الإحداثي الرأسي الذي وقع فيه الحدث بالنسبة لأصل نظام إحداثيات الشاشة.
[DOMName("screenY")]
public long ScreenY { get; }
قيمة الخاصية
ShiftKey
تشير إلى خاصية shiftKey.
[DOMName("shiftKey")]
public bool ShiftKey { get; }